Guide to the Mangroves of Florida
... The word “mangrove” is derived from the Portuguese word for tree (mangue) and the English word for a stand of trees (grove). There are three principal mangrove species in Florida—red, white and black. An associated species, buttonwood, is usually found growing nearby. Florida mangroves have leaves t ...

Banana Bunchy Top: Detailed Signs and Symptoms
... Maturing plants: On mature plants infected with BBTV, new leaves emerge with difficulty, are narrower than normal, are wavy rather than flat, and have yellow (chlorotic) leaf margins. They appear to be “bunched” at the top of the plant, the symptom for which this disease is named. Severely infected ...

Rainforest biome - Prairie Central
... The emergents are widely spaced trees. They grow 100 to 120 feet. Emergents have umbrella shaped canopies that extend above the general canopy of the forest. Since they must contend with drying winds, they tend to have small leaves. Some species are decidous during the brief dry season. ...
